French
Etymology 1
Pronunciation
Noun
marnage m (plural marnages)
- (hydrology) tidal range; rise and fall of the level of a body of water
Etymology 2
Pronunciation
Noun
marnage m (plural marnages)
- (agriculture) action of improving the quality of land by adding marl
